In a recent interview, former President Donald Trump’s Director of the National Economic Council, Gary Cohn, expressed his agreement with consumers who are frustrated by the inflation caused by President Joe Biden’s American Rescue Plan. Cohn made these remarks during an appearance on CBS News’ “Face The Nation” with Margaret Brennan, where they discussed Biden’s comments about billionaires.
Responding to Biden’s claim that billionaires don’t pay taxes in the U.S., Cohn strongly disagreed, stating that any billionaire with income in the country is paying at least 20 percent in taxes. He emphasized that the U.S. does a good job of taxing income, as outlined in the Constitution. Cohn explained that even tax-free bonds are subject to a minimum of 20 percent tax on interest, dividends, or capital gains.
Brennan then brought up Biden’s attempt to incite anger against corporations, accusing them of taking advantage of the average person. Cohn shifted the conversation to the topic of inflation, highlighting its compounding effect. He explained that inflation accumulates year after year, and it’s not a reset to zero each time. Using the example of a basket of groceries that cost $100 at the beginning of 2020, Cohn illustrated how the cumulative effect of inflation can significantly increase prices over time.
Brennan acknowledged that consumers were indeed facing higher costs due to inflation, contradicting the notion that they were mistaken. Cohn agreed, stating that consumers were rightfully frustrated because inflation was eroding their purchasing power and making it nearly impossible for them to invest in their futures, such as buying a home.
